Sir Paul McCartney has announced details of a new European tour, which will climax in London on December 22.
The seven-date tour, which begins in Hamburg on December 2, will mark the former Beatle's first European tour for five years.
Entitled Good Evening Europe, the tour will also call in Berlin (December 3), Arnhem (December 9) and Paris (December 10).
Sir Paul will also play dates in Cologne (December 16) and Dublin (December 20) before calling in London.
The singer's gig at the O2 Arena is set to take place 46 years to the day since the Beatles' first Christmas gig at the Liverpool Empire Theatre.
"This is my chance to bring our current show home to where it all began. Starting in Hamburg, ending in London and rocking everywhere in between,” Sir Paul said.
“I'm very much looking forward to ending the year on a high."
